Daniel Jones

Bio:

Dr. Daniel Jones is a composer, arranger, trumpeter, educational leader and researcher. Jones has published over 30 original compositions and arrangements for concert band, brass ensemble, and trumpet. His concert band pieces have been published by Wingert-Jones, Print Music Source, and Imagine Music Publications and his brass music has been published by Cimarron Music Press, Mentor Music, and Cherry Classics. Jones is an active trumpeter in St. Louis, playing with the Civic Orchestra and subbing with several other ensembles. He has previously performed with the Des Moines Symphony, Des Moines Metro Opera Orchestra, Central Iowa Symphony, and Fort Dodge Area Symphony. Jones earned his Master of Music in Trumpet Performance from Southwestern Oklahoma State University, where he studied with Dr. James South, and his Bachelor of Music Education from Iowa State University, where he studied trumpet with Dr. James Bovinette. Jones currently serves as an Assistant Principal at Riverview Gardens High School in St. Louis and previously taught Music, German, and English in St. Louis and Des Moines, Iowa. Having recently earned his PhD in Educational Leadership from St. Louis University, Dr. Jones' dissertation highlighted the use of the arts to enhance school administration, professional development, and leadership behaviors. Dr. Jones has also published scholarly articles discussing the use of educational calendars, language contact phenomena, music pedagogy, and musicology. Jones lives with his family in Chesterfield, Missouri.
